Why Speed Hurts Growth

Slow Pages Lose Visitors

Every extra second of load time increases bounce rates and reduces conversions — especially on mobile.

Traffic without engagement

Poor Core Web Vitals

LCP, INP, and CLS issues hurt user experience and can affect search visibility.

SEO and UX both suffer

Heavy Images & Scripts

Unoptimized media, bloated plugins, and third-party scripts drag performance down.

Death by a thousand requests

Hosting & Caching Misconfigured

The site may be well-built but poorly served — caching, CDN, and server response times matter.

Fast code, slow delivery

Will this guarantee better rankings?

No. Speed is a ranking factor among many. Performance work improves UX and removes a common SEO barrier — it doesn't guarantee position changes.

Do you work on WordPress and Shopify?

Yes. Performance bottlenecks differ by platform; we optimize within your stack.

Is this separate from technical SEO?

Overlapping but focused. Technical SEO covers broader search foundations; performance optimization goes deep on speed and Core Web Vitals.
